Reed HR are working with a Charity based in South East London to recruit a HR Business Partner, on a Part Time basis (4 days per week), covering a 12 month Fixed Term Contract.

The main purpose of this role is to provide effective and efficient HR Operational Support to Line Managers and Employees alike throughout the charity on a range of HR related Policies and Procedures, Employee Relations Casework, Recruitment and more.

Some of the roles and responsibilities for this position are as follows:

- Act as first point of contact for any and all HR related queries and issues.

- Provide consistent, comprehensive and professional HR advice and support to managers on a full range of HR issues, including employee
relations, ensuring the advice and support is in line with policies, procedures and is legally compliant, escalating when necessary.

- Provide accurate and timely advice and training, where appropriate, to all staff regarding HR policies, procedures and use of the HR
information system

- Actively support managers to recruit cost effectively using safer recruitment techniques and provide an effective recruitment service
presenting a positive impression of the organisation and attracting high quality applicants

- Develop, conduct and review HR inductions ensuring all new employees receive a high quality induction experience. Conduct exit interviews and ensure leaver data is entered correctly onto the HR system

- Maintain the HRIS ensuring all data is complete, accurate and secure in line with GDPR requirements

- Monitor sickness absence and conduct return to work interviews when necessary.

- Support the management of employee relations cases and change management. Provide advice and support to line managers, preparing case documentation and ensuring procedural timescales are adhered to and ensure a consistent and fair approach to people and change
management.

- Review pay and rewards, and benchmark against similar organisations. Support the review of employee benefits and pension scheme.

- Review and update HR policies and procedures as agreed with Head of HR

- Support and undertake HR projects, as agreed with Head of HR

To be successful in this position, you will already have solid experience within a HR Advisory Capacity or Senior HR Officer role. You will have be confident to take the lead on any Employee Relations casework, including Disciplinary/Grievance cases. Ideally you will be available on short notice.
